Whitefield to Badnera Jn by train, with one change

No train runs the whole way from Whitefield to Badnera Jn. Changing at Gudur Jn takes 25 hr 3 min, and the quickest pairing is 17209 then 20625.

1 change · 874 km apart · fastest 25 hr 3 min · Daily except Sat

Whitefield to Badnera Jn by train

Is there a direct train from Whitefield to Badnera Jn?
No. No single train runs from Whitefield to Badnera Jn. The journey takes one change, at Gudur Jn, and the fastest combination takes 25 hr 3 min.
What is the fastest way from Whitefield to Badnera Jn by train?
17209 SESHADRI EXP departs Whitefield at 11:54 and reaches Gudur Jn at 19:13. 20625 MAS BGKT SF EXP then departs at 21:45 and arrives Badnera Jn at 12:57. Total 25 hr 3 min, with 2 hr 32 min to change.
Where do you change trains between Whitefield and Badnera Jn?
Gudur Jn (GDR) is the interchange on the fastest route, with 2 hr 32 min between the arriving and departing trains.
Which days can you travel from Whitefield to Badnera Jn?
Connections are available on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day and Sunday.
